Air-Fried Potstickers
Created by: Howcan Team
Ingredients
- 24 round potsticker wrappers
- 1/2 pound ground pork
- 1 cup shredded cabbage
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 1 teaspoon sesame oil
- 1/2 teaspoon grated ginger
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 1/4 cup water
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ine 1/2 pound of ground pork, 1 cup of shredded cabbage, 2 cloves of minced garlic, 1 tablespoon of soy sauce, 1 teaspoon of sesame oil, 1/2 teaspoon of grated ginger, and 1/4 teaspoon of black pepper.
- Place a small spoonful of the pork mixture in the center of each potsticker wrapper. Moisten the edges with water and fold the wrapper in half, pleating the edges to seal.
- Preheat the air fryer to 375°F (190°C). Brush the potstickers with vegetable oil and place them in the air fryer basket in a single layer.
- Air fry the potstickers for 8-10 minutes, until they are golden and crispy.
- Carefully remove the potstickers from the air fryer and serve with a dipping sauce of your choice.

Air-fried potstickers have a rich history rooted in traditional Chinese cuisine. Originating in the northern regions of China, these delectable dumplings were traditionally pan-fried, but the introduction of air-frying has revolutionized their preparation. Renowned chefs like Ming Tsai and Martin Yan have popularized this method, creating a healthier alternative to the classic dish. The key to perfect air-fried potstickers lies in the delicate balance of a crispy exterior and juicy, flavorful filling. Today, the best versions of this dish can be found in authentic Chinese restaurants that have mastered the art of crafting these savory parcels. The most important elements to get right are the filling, which typically consists of a blend of ground meat, vegetables, and seasonings, and the thin, tender dough that encases it. For a unique twist, consider incorporating alternative ingredients such as shrimp or tofu for a personalized touch.
